#!/usr/bin/env python
# coding: utf-8
# In[1]:
import requests
import numpy as np
import h5py
baseUrl = 'http://www.illustris-project.org/api/'
headers = {"api-key" : "YOUR_KEY_FROM_ILLUSTRISTNG"}
# In[2]:
def get(path, params=None, fName='temp'): # gets data from url, saves to file
"""
Routine to pull data from online
"""
# make HTTP GET request to path
if (len(headers['api-key'])!=32):
print("Have you put in your API key? This one isn't working")
print('Currently it is: ',headers['api-key'])
print('You can find your API key on the Illustris website:')
print('http://www.illustris-project.org/data/')
print('and update it in this program using')
print("iApi.headers['api-key']='*MYAPIKEY*'")
print("Or permanently change it in iApi.py")
r = requests.get(path, params=params, headers=headers)
# raise exception if response code is not HTTP SUCCESS (200)
r.raise_for_status()
if r.headers['content-type'] == 'application/json':
return r.json() # parse json responses automatically
dataFile=fName+'.hdf5'
# Saves to file, currently disabled
if 'content-disposition' in r.headers:
filename = r.headers['content-disposition'].split("filename=")[1]
with open(dataFile, 'wb') as f:
f.write(r.content)
return dataFile # return the filename string
return r
# In[3]:
def getGalaxy(gal, fields, simulation='Illustris-1', snapshot=135,
fileName='tempGal', rewriteFile=1, getHalo=0):
fields=np.array(fields) # converts to array
order=np.argsort(fields[:,0])
disorder=np.argsort(order) # needed to unsort the fields later...
fields=fields[order,:] # orders by particle type
nFields=order.size
if rewriteFile==1: # redownloads file from the internet
url='https://www.tng-project.org/api/'+simulation+'/snapshots/'+str(snapshot)+'/subhalos/'+str(gal)+'/cutout.hdf5?'
if getHalo==1:
url='https://www.tng-project.org/api/'+simulation+'/snapshots/'+str(snapshot)+'/halos/'+str(gal)+'/cutout.hdf5?'
thisParticle=0
thisEntry=0
firstParticle=1
while thisParticle<6: # cycles through all particle type
if (int(fields[thisEntry,0])!=thisParticle): # checks there is at least one field for this particle
thisParticle+=1
continue
if firstParticle==1: # first particle requires no ampersand
firstParticle=0
else: # all later particles do
url+='&'
particleTypeNames=['gas','dm','error','tracers','stars','bhs']
url+=particleTypeNames[thisParticle]+'=' # adds the name of the particle type
firstEntry=1
while int(fields[thisEntry,0])==thisParticle:
if firstEntry==1: #first entry requires no comma
firstEntry=0
else: # all later entries do
url+=','
url+=fields[thisEntry,1] # adds every associated field
thisEntry+=1
if thisEntry==nFields:
break
if thisEntry==nFields:
break
thisParticle+=1
dataFile=get(url,fName=fileName)
# end of "if rewriteFile==1:"
if rewriteFile == 0: # if we're not redownloading need to set path to the file
dataFile=fileName+'.hdf5'
# gets a dictionary for unit conversions
#units=changeUnits.makeParticleDict(simulation=simulation,snapshot=snapshot)
# actually get the data (saved to .hdf5 file)
data=[] # initially empty list that we will fill up with the data
with h5py.File(dataFile,'r') as f:
for i in range(disorder.size):
thisField=fields[disorder[i],:] # ensures data returned in original order of fields
#!!!!!!!!!
# data.append(units[thisField[1]]*np.array(f['PartType'+thisField[0]][thisField[1]]))
data.append(np.array(f['PartType'+thisField[0]][thisField[1]]))
# returns all particle data of each field as a numpy array
return data # returns all the particle fields as a list of numpy arrays in the same order as initial fields
# In[4]:
def getSubhaloField(field, simulation='Illustris-1', snapshot=135,
fileName='tempCat', rewriteFile=1):
if rewriteFile==1: # redownloads file from the internet
url='https://www.tng-project.org/api/'+simulation+'/files/groupcat-'+str(snapshot)+'/?Subhalo='+field
dataFile=get(url,fName=fileName)
if rewriteFile == 0: # if we're not redownloading need to set path to the file
dataFile=fileName+'.hdf5'
with h5py.File(dataFile,'r') as f:
data=np.array(f['Subhalo'][field])
return data
